Suspension

The quality of the suspension on a 3-wheel double buggy is crucial to how it will be easy for you and your baby to push. It is essential to have a smooth ride, since babies feel every bump on the road. This is especially true if you are driving on rough terrain such as grass or roads that are not paved. Certain models also have locking front wheels to assist in maneuvering and navigating obstacles such as curbs.

Some models have air-filled tyres that are great for all-terrain rides, but they can be prone punctures. Make sure you keep a spare set of tyres inside the trunk. Others have foam or gel tyres, which are specifically designed to handle bumps and are less prone to punctures but you might find them to be a bit stiff and uncomfortable for your child's back when you decide to jog.
